Love Sanborn Graham 1702–1725 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 30 Aug 1702

Birth Location: Kingston, Rockingham, New Hampshire, United States

Death Date: 1 March 1725

Death Location: Stafford, Connecticut, USA

Father: Jonathan Samborne

Mother: Elisabeth Sherburn

Spouse(s): John Graham

Children(s): Rev Graham, Elizabeth Bull, Chauncy Graham, Robert Graham

In 1702, Love Sanborn Graham entered the world in Kingston, Rockingham, New Hampshire, United States, born to Jonathan Samborne And Elisabeth Sherburn. Love Sanborn Graham married John Graham, and had children including Chauncy Graham, Elizabeth Bull, Rev John Jr Graham, Robert Graham. Love Sanborn Graham passed away in 1725 in Stafford, Connecticut, USA.
